Who are the models featured in Slim Aarons: Women?

1 Answers2025-12-03 16:36:25
Slim Aarons' photography book 'Women' is a gorgeous collection that captures the elegance and effortless charm of high society ladies from the mid-20th century. The models featured aren't professional models in the traditional sense—they're socialites, actresses, and influential women of their time, often photographed in luxurious settings like poolside villas or sprawling estates. Names like C.Z. Guest, the American socialite and horticulturalist, and Princess Ira von Fürstenberg, the heiress and actress, pop up frequently in his work. These women embodied a certain glamour that was both unpretentious and aspirational, perfectly aligning with Aarons' signature style of 'attractive people doing attractive things in attractive places.'

What I love about Aarons' approach is how he made these women feel like they weren’t posing for a camera but simply existing in their natural element. Whether it’s Lady Daphne Cameron lounging by a pool in Capri or the Duchess of Windsor mingling at a party, each image tells a story beyond just fashion or beauty. It’s a snapshot of a bygone era where leisure and sophistication intertwined seamlessly. If you’re into vintage photography or just appreciate the aesthetics of old-money elegance, flipping through 'Women' feels like stepping into a time capsule—one filled with martinis, sun-kissed skin, and impeccable style.

Can I download Slim Aarons: Women legally?

1 Answers2025-12-03 09:27:24
Slim Aarons' photography is iconic, and his work captures a glamorous, mid-century aesthetic that feels timeless. If you're looking to download his famous 'Women' collection legally, it's a bit tricky but doable with the right approach. First, you need to understand that Slim Aarons' estate manages the rights to his work, and unauthorized downloads or distributions can land you in legal trouble. The best way to access his images is through official channels like licensed stock photo websites, galleries, or publishers that have agreements with the estate. For example, Getty Images represents a lot of his work, and you can purchase high-resolution downloads there for personal or editorial use.

If you're hoping for free downloads, you might be out of luck unless you stumble upon public domain archives—but most of Aarons' work isn't in that category. Some museums or educational sites might offer limited previews, but they’re usually low-res or watermarked. I’ve seen a few art books compiling his 'Women' series, like 'Slim Aarons: Women,' which you can buy digitally or physically. It’s worth the investment if you’re a fan; the print quality does justice to his vibrant, sun-soaked portraits. Honestly, supporting the official releases feels better than hunting sketchy download links—it keeps the artist’s legacy alive and respects copyright.
